This is what you need to do to fully utilize the Android:

1. Tap on "Applications", this takes you to a new screen with all of the installed applications
2. If you have AndExplorer, you have 2.0.2 firmware and you should update your firmware to 2.0.3
3. If you have IOFileManager, then you already have 2.0.3 firmware.
4. Tap on Settings to set up you wifi
5. Tap on SlideMe (SAM) and search and download Launcher Pro
6. Hit the home button and make Launcher Pro your default launcher
7. You are set.

If you cannot go to the next screen by tapping on the "Applications" icon, I would reflash the firmware.

1. Press and hold the power button until "Power Off" appears, tap it to power the device off.
2. put the firmware in the root off the SD card.
3. Press and hold the Power button and the Volume Up button until you see an android/box with a progress bar.

To be safe, I always flash 2.0.2 first (http://www.mediafire.com/?vcvchc6jjhdkqba)
then flash 2.0.3

Flashing 2.0.2:

copy the file and only this file to your SD card:

pocket.IQ.firmware 2.0.2_041210_NA_PB701SWUPDATE.zip

1. Press and hold the power button until the power off screen comes on.
2. Press power off.
3. Press AND hold BOTH the power button and the volume up button until a screen with the box, yello arrow and android logo comes on
4. Let go of the buttons.
5. IQ will reboot afterward.
6. Go through the set up steps on the screen.

Now you are ready to flash version 2.0.3:

Delete the 2.0.2 firmware from your SD card, copy this file to the SD Card:

userupdate091210_common_PB701SWUPDATE.zip


Follow the steps outlined in version 2.0.2.
